Emerald HoldCo B.V. has moved to consolidate its ownership of Beta Glass Plc by launching a mandatory takeover offer to acquire up to 11.74 million ordinary shares at ₦590.94 per share after securing an indirect controlling stake in the glass manufacturer.
Beta Glass disclosed the development in a notice to the Nigerian Exchange Limited (NGX) on Tuesday, stating that the offer follows Emerald HoldCo’s acquisition of the Frigoglass Group’s interest in the company earlier this year.
According to the notice, Emerald HoldCo completed the acquisition of 100 per cent of the shares of Emerald Nigeria Intermediate Holdings B.V., formerly Frigoinvest Nigeria Holding B.V., in February 2026.
As a result of the transaction, Emerald HoldCo assumed indirect ownership of 331.26 million ordinary shares in Beta Glass, representing about 55.22 per cent of the company’s issued share capital.
The shares were previously held by the Frigoglass Group through Emerald Nigeria Intermediate Holdings B.V.
The acquisition gave Emerald HoldCo majority control of Beta Glass and triggered a mandatory takeover requirement under the Investments and Securities Act 2025, the Securities and Exchange Commission (SEC) Rules and Regulations, and the SEC Rules on Mergers, Takeovers and Acquisitions.

“Emerald HoldCo is required to make a Take-over Offer to all other shareholders of Beta Glass,” the company stated.
It, however, explained that under the Nigeria Takeover Rules, an acquirer may make an offer for all or only a portion of the shares held by minority shareholders.
It stated further that Emerald HoldCo is seeking to acquire up to 11,741,509 ordinary shares, representing about 1.96 per cent of Beta Glass’ total issued and fully paid share capital, at an offer price of ₦590.94 per share.
“The Offer is therefore being undertaken in accordance with the directives of the regulatory authorities and pursuant to the Nigeria Takeover Rules for a portion of the outstanding shares,” Beta Glass said.
It noted that the offer excludes the shares already held by Packaging Industries Nigeria Limited and Emerald Nigeria Intermediate Holdings B.V.
It also noted that the board of directors of Emerald HoldCo approved the transaction on February 5, 2026, authorising the takeover offer to the company’s remaining eligible shareholders.
Beta Glass added that the SEC has approved the offer, while June 25, 2026, has been set as the qualification date for shareholders eligible to participate in the transaction.
